GET api/Subcontracts/{subcontractId}/SectionsBasicInfo

Get all sections (only basic info) for a subcontract given the subcontract id

Request Information

URI Parameters

NameDescriptionTypeAdditional information
subcontractId

integer

Required

Body Parameters

None.

Response Information

Resource Description

Collection of SectionBasicInfoDto
NameDescriptionTypeAdditional information
SubcontractId

integer

None.

Id

integer

None.

Title

string

None.

Code

string

None.

SectionStatusId

SectionStatusId

None.

SectionStatusDescription

string

None.

SectionScopeType

SectionScopeTypeDto

None.

SectionTypeId

SectionTypeId

None.

CertificationModeId

CertificationModeId

None.

SectionTypeDescription

string

None.

CertificationModeDescription

string

None.

ActualScopeId

integer

None.

SectionVersionId

integer

None.

SectionVersionNumber

integer

None.

SignedPrice

decimal number

None.

CreatedDate

date

None.

UpdatedDate

date

None.

CodeAsNumber

integer

None.

Response Formats

application/json, text/json

Sample:
[
  {
    "subcontractId": 1,
    "id": 2,
    "title": "sample string 3",
    "code": "sample string 4",
    "sectionStatusId": 1,
    "sectionStatusDescription": "sample string 5",
    "sectionScopeType": {
      "id": 1,
      "name": "sample string 1",
      "description": "sample string 2"
    },
    "sectionTypeId": 0,
    "certificationModeId": 1,
    "sectionTypeDescription": "sample string 6",
    "certificationModeDescription": "sample string 7",
    "actualScopeId": 1,
    "sectionVersionId": 8,
    "sectionVersionNumber": 9,
    "signedPrice": 1.0,
    "createdDate": "2026-05-08T21:19:32.5083929+02:00",
    "updatedDate": "2026-05-08T21:19:32.5083929+02:00",
    "codeAsNumber": 10
  },
  {
    "subcontractId": 1,
    "id": 2,
    "title": "sample string 3",
    "code": "sample string 4",
    "sectionStatusId": 1,
    "sectionStatusDescription": "sample string 5",
    "sectionScopeType": {
      "id": 1,
      "name": "sample string 1",
      "description": "sample string 2"
    },
    "sectionTypeId": 0,
    "certificationModeId": 1,
    "sectionTypeDescription": "sample string 6",
    "certificationModeDescription": "sample string 7",
    "actualScopeId": 1,
    "sectionVersionId": 8,
    "sectionVersionNumber": 9,
    "signedPrice": 1.0,
    "createdDate": "2026-05-08T21:19:32.5083929+02:00",
    "updatedDate": "2026-05-08T21:19:32.5083929+02:00",
    "codeAsNumber": 10
  }
]

text/html

Sample:
[{"subcontractId":1,"id":2,"title":"sample string 3","code":"sample string 4","sectionStatusId":1,"sectionStatusDescription":"sample string 5","sectionScopeType":{"id":1,"name":"sample string 1","description":"sample string 2"},"sectionTypeId":0,"certificationModeId":1,"sectionTypeDescription":"sample string 6","certificationModeDescription":"sample string 7","actualScopeId":1,"sectionVersionId":8,"sectionVersionNumber":9,"signedPrice":1.0,"createdDate":"2026-05-08T21:19:32.5083929+02:00","updatedDate":"2026-05-08T21:19:32.5083929+02:00","codeAsNumber":10},{"subcontractId":1,"id":2,"title":"sample string 3","code":"sample string 4","sectionStatusId":1,"sectionStatusDescription":"sample string 5","sectionScopeType":{"id":1,"name":"sample string 1","description":"sample string 2"},"sectionTypeId":0,"certificationModeId":1,"sectionTypeDescription":"sample string 6","certificationModeDescription":"sample string 7","actualScopeId":1,"sectionVersionId":8,"sectionVersionNumber":9,"signedPrice":1.0,"createdDate":"2026-05-08T21:19:32.5083929+02:00","updatedDate":"2026-05-08T21:19:32.5083929+02:00","codeAsNumber":10}]

application/xml, text/xml

Sample:
<ArrayOfSectionBasicInfoDto x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/TR.eSAM.SubcontractModule.Application.Dtos.Dtos.SectionAgg">
  <SectionBasicInfoDto>
    <ActualScopeId>1</ActualScopeId>
    <CertificationModeDescription>sample string 7</CertificationModeDescription>
    <CertificationModeId>Administration</CertificationModeId>
    <Code>sample string 4</Code>
    <CodeAsNumber>10</CodeAsNumber>
    <CreatedDate>2026-05-08T21:19:32.5083929+02:00</CreatedDate>
    <Id>2</Id>
    <SectionScopeType>
      <Description>sample string 2</Description>
      <Id>Mca</Id>
      <Name>sample string 1</Name>
    </SectionScopeType>
    <SectionStatusDescription>sample string 5</SectionStatusDescription>
    <SectionStatusId>Draft</SectionStatusId>
    <SectionTypeDescription>sample string 6</SectionTypeDescription>
    <SectionTypeId>Default</SectionTypeId>
    <SectionVersionId>8</SectionVersionId>
    <SectionVersionNumber>9</SectionVersionNumber>
    <SignedPrice>1</SignedPrice>
    <SubcontractId>1</SubcontractId>
    <Title>sample string 3</Title>
    <UpdatedDate>2026-05-08T21:19:32.5083929+02:00</UpdatedDate>
  </SectionBasicInfoDto>
  <SectionBasicInfoDto>
    <ActualScopeId>1</ActualScopeId>
    <CertificationModeDescription>sample string 7</CertificationModeDescription>
    <CertificationModeId>Administration</CertificationModeId>
    <Code>sample string 4</Code>
    <CodeAsNumber>10</CodeAsNumber>
    <CreatedDate>2026-05-08T21:19:32.5083929+02:00</CreatedDate>
    <Id>2</Id>
    <SectionScopeType>
      <Description>sample string 2</Description>
      <Id>Mca</Id>
      <Name>sample string 1</Name>
    </SectionScopeType>
    <SectionStatusDescription>sample string 5</SectionStatusDescription>
    <SectionStatusId>Draft</SectionStatusId>
    <SectionTypeDescription>sample string 6</SectionTypeDescription>
    <SectionTypeId>Default</SectionTypeId>
    <SectionVersionId>8</SectionVersionId>
    <SectionVersionNumber>9</SectionVersionNumber>
    <SignedPrice>1</SignedPrice>
    <SubcontractId>1</SubcontractId>
    <Title>sample string 3</Title>
    <UpdatedDate>2026-05-08T21:19:32.5083929+02:00</UpdatedDate>
  </SectionBasicInfoDto>
</ArrayOfSectionBasicInfoDto>